Spring is one of the best times of year to visit Yass Valley, in the southwest slopes of NSW. The region brims with exciting spring events, with an event perfect for all ages and interests.

The valley has burst into life with events, the first of which was the recent Irish & Celtic Music Festival. This three-day music festival offered poetry, dancing, Celtic markets, food, drinks and more.

According to Georgia Patmore, acting Tourism and Business Liaison Coordinator Manager for Yass Valley, the music festival started the celebrations in September.

“Spring in Yass Valley is the time for warmer weather, for the arrival of fresh growth, and for visitors to the region to get out and about and enjoy the fresh country air and some fabulous spring events with our locals,” Georgia said.

“This is the busiest time of year for our events, with everything from local food and wine, to gardens, music and a little history thrown in. There’s an event perfect for any visitor to Yass Valley throughout spring.”

Tantalise your tastebuds at this roving degustation of fine local wines matched with delicious tasting plates at the Murrumbateman Moving Feast from 5-6 October 2019.

“In October, we showcase the region’s food and cool climate wines at the Murrumbateman Moving Feast, along with music and family entertainment at the Gundaroo Music Festival.”

“We round out spring with two heritage events in November, taking a trip back to yesteryear with Classic Yass and the Bowning Country Fair. And food and wine enthusiasts can sip their way through more wines with delicious food and live music at the Hills of Hall Spring Wine Festival.”

Yass Valley is located around three hours’ drive from Sydney, and just half-an-hour from Canberra, and makes the perfect weekend or a short-break destination. Yass Valley comprises the beautiful country towns of Yass, Binalong, Bowning, Gundaroo, Sutton, Wee Jasper, Bookham, Burrinjuck, Murrumbateman and Wallaroo.

Events in the Yass Valley

Murrumbateman Moving Feast

5-6 October 2019

Held at various venues within the Murrumbateman township.

Tantalise your taste buds at this roving degustation of fine local wines matched with delicious tasting plates at the best of Murrumbateman’s local wineries. There’s no better way to spend your October long weekend.

Gundaroo Music Festival

26 October 2019

Cork Street, Gundaroo

Music lovers unite for family entertainment, local food and wine, art stalls and more at this 12- hour festival celebrating music in Gundaroo. Raising awareness of Motor Neurone Disease, the evening concludes with a fireworks display.

Classic Yass

2 November 2019

Meehan Street, Yass

Take a trip back to yesteryear with cars from the early 1900s through to the ‘70s, vintage memorabilia, music from the ‘50s, ‘60s and ‘70s. Billy Cart Derby, markets, motor show and more. Class Yass visits the ‘good old days’ in the centre of Yass.

Hills of Hall

2-3 November 2019

Held at various venues in and around Wallaroo

The hills are alive! Hills of Hall wineries, that is. Get ready to taste delicious cool climate wines and food, taste new releases and enjoy live music at various venues taking part in this delightful spring wine festival.

Bowning Country Fair

17 November 2019

Rollonin Café, Bowning

Enjoy this big dose of country charm as the Rollonin Café hosts this country fair complete with market stalls, live entertainment, antique farm machinery, sheep shearing and more.
